2014: The Year of Radiant Orchid
So, the results are in, and the 2014 pantone color will be radiant orchid... so that means get ready to see it plastered everywhere! I knew we were about due for a pantone in the purple family, so my prediction was pretty accurate. If you are getting married this year, and want to incorporate this vibrant color into your big day, you'll find some great inspirations below!
Being in the purple family, this color is great for your floral design, décor accents, and is also a great partner with gold. One of my favorite ways to use this color is in your lighting (hello, great photos)! However, I am going to put it out there that this color can be overused and overdone, so you want to pair it with great accents, and don't plaster it all over your big day - it should be incorporated, but not your signature color.
